City of Oceanside
The City of Oceanside is accepting applications for the position of Police Officer - Entry Level. This recruitment will be used to fill vacancies for the Regional Peace Officer POST Academy.
Are you interested in a career in law enforcement? Look no further than the Oceanside Police Department, serving the City of Oceanside. The City of Oceanside, CA (population 178,000) is a thriving beachfront community centrally located in the heart of the beautiful Southern California coastline.
Police Officers patrol assigned areas by vehicle, bicycle or on foot to answer service calls for the protection of life and property. Duties include conducting investigations; identifying and collecting evidence; directing traffic; making arrests; issuing citations; serving warrants and subpoenas; preparing reports; and working with the community to identify problems and solutions.
Responsibilities and Qualifications
Applicants must possess a high school diploma or General Education Development (GED) certificate or equivalent; Must be twenty (20) years and six (6) months on the date you apply and twenty one years by the date of Academy graduation; be a U.S. Citizen or a permanent resident who has applied for U.S. Citizenship. Special Requirements: Possess a valid Class C California Driver's license at time of appointment. Pass a thorough background investigation, polygraph examination, psychological evaluation and medical examination which will include a pre-employment drug screening. Not have been convicted of a felony or serving probation. Examination Process
The applicant examination process is divided into separate phases: written, a pre-background questionnaire, and physical agility. Individuals must successfully complete each phase prior to advancing to the next. A written examination (POST PELLETB) designed to assess job-related skills. A Pre-Investigative Questionnaire (PIQ). Physical Agility Test (PAT) consisting of four events: 25 push-ups in 1 minute; 30 sit-ups in 1 minute; 165-pound dummy drag - 32 feet within 28 seconds; and 1.5 mile run in 14 minutes and 55 seconds (14:55). Compensation
UPON GRADUATION FROM THE ACADEMY: Police Officer, $7,585 - $10,306 per month, $91,021 - $123,677 per year. WHILE IN THE ACADEMY: Police Officer Recruit, $34.37 per hour. A bilingual premium (Samoan, Spanish or ASL) of $1.73 per hour will be paid to those employees who pass the bilingual examination. Equal Opportunity Employer
